是的,Netty和Kafka可以一起用于處理大數據。Netty是一個高性能的網絡應用框架,而Kafka是一個分布式流處理平臺,它們可以共同處理和分析大量數據。以下是它們的相關介紹:
Netty和Kafka處理大數據的能力
- Netty的高性能:Netty采用異步非阻塞通信模型,能夠支持高并發的網絡連接,同時處理多個連接請求,提升了系統的吞吐量和處理能力。
- Kafka的分布式處理:Kafka通過分區、復制、批處理和分布式消費等技術,能夠處理大規模數據的傳輸和處理,確保數據的高可靠性和容錯性。
實際應用案例
- SpringBoot整合Kafka實現千萬級數據異步處理:通過SpringBoot技術框架,結合Netty和Kafka,可以實現千萬級數據的異步處理,展示了Netty和Kafka在大數據處理中的應用潛力。
擴展性
- Kafka的集群擴展性:Kafka通過水平擴展、分區擴展、動態調整和自動負載均衡等功能,可以實現集群的擴展,滿足各種規模和性能要求的應用場景。
Netty和Kafka的結合使用,可以有效地處理和分析大數據,滿足現代數據處理的高性能和高擴展性需求。